    The Loudoun County Chamber of Commerce and the Economic Development Authority of Loudoun Co. recently announced their inaugural Young Entrepreneurs Academy. It's a national program that provides hands-on entrepreneurial training to students between grades 6 through 12 and classes begin in October.

    The program lasts for seven months and students will meet most Tuesday evenings from 5:00pm - 8:00pm. One recent graduate, a seventh grader from Florida, appeared on Shark Tank. The program also partners with the Mason Enterprise Center, Loudoun County Public Schools, and Loudoun Youth, Inc.

    The program sounds pretty amazing and a great way for students to differentiate themselves. There are 3 information sessions 8/10, 8/24, and 9/7 and more information you can visit http://www.loudounchamber.org/YEA.
